The Ronseal Reputation: Quality and Reliability Since 1932
Ronseal's story began in Rotherham, Yorkshire, where the company developed wood treatment products for the growing British building industry. The name itself combines the company's location (Rotherham) with their original product focus (sealant), creating a brand that has become synonymous with effective timber protection.
The famous "Does exactly what it says on the tin" advertising campaign perfectly captures Ronseal's approach: honest products that deliver promised results without surprises or disappointments. This straightforward philosophy has made Ronseal Britain's best-selling wood care brand, trusted by professionals and DIY users alike.

Wood Stains: Enhancing Timber's Natural Beauty
Ronseal's wood stain range represents their core offering, providing solutions that enhance timber's natural grain while delivering protection from moisture, UV damage, and wear. Our paints collection includes comprehensive Ronseal wood stain selections for interior and exterior applications.
The Ultimate Protection Hardwood Oil offers advanced protection for hardwood garden furniture, decking, and outdoor structures. Its unique formula penetrates deep into timber, providing water resistance while allowing the wood to breathe naturally. This prevents the moisture trapping that causes rot in traditional surface coatings.
For general exterior timber, Ronseal's Fence Life Plus delivers long-lasting color and protection for fences, sheds, and garden structures. Available in multiple natural wood tones and contemporary colors, it provides up to five years of protection in a single coat, making it exceptionally efficient for large-area applications.
Interior wood stains include the classic Quick Drying Woodstain for furniture, doors, and architectural woodwork. The fast-drying formula allows multiple coats in a day, speeding project completion while delivering rich, even color that enhances timber grain. Available in traditional oak, mahogany, and walnut tones plus contemporary greys, it suits both period restoration and modern styling.
Decking Stains and Protection
Ronseal's decking range addresses the specific challenges of horizontal timber surfaces exposed to heavy wear and constant weathering. Decking Stain combines color with water-repellent protection, preventing the greying and splitting that occurs when decking weathers naturally. The non-slip formulation ensures safe footing even when wet.
For existing weathered decking, Ronseal manufactures Decking Rescue Paint, which covers tired, grey timber with opaque protection. Unlike traditional paints that peel and flake, this specialized formulation remains flexible, moving with the timber to prevent cracking and maintain appearance through years of outdoor exposure.
Varnishes: Clear Protection for Interior Timber
Ronseal's varnish range provides transparent protection for interior woodwork, allowing timber's natural beauty to show while defending against moisture, wear, and household use. The selection covers everything from heavy-duty floor varnishes to delicate furniture finishes.
Diamond Hard Floor Varnish represents Ronseal's toughest clear finish, engineered specifically for hardwood floors that face constant foot traffic, furniture movement, and cleaning. The advanced formula resists scratching and scuffing significantly better than standard varnishes, maintaining floor appearance through years of family use.
For furniture and joinery, the Interior Varnish range includes gloss, satin, and matt finishes in various formulations. Quick-dry versions allow project completion in a day, while traditional formulations provide maximum depth and clarity for fine furniture where premium appearance matters more than application speed.
Yacht Varnish brings marine-grade durability to interior applications, providing exceptional resistance to heat and moisture. This makes it ideal for windowsills, kitchen worktops, and other surfaces facing challenging exposure despite being indoors.
Specialist Clear Finishes
Beyond standard varnishes, Ronseal manufactures specialized clear coatings for particular requirements. Stays White Ultra Tough Varnish prevents the yellowing that occurs with traditional clear finishes, maintaining the crisp appearance of painted or light-colored timber. This is particularly valuable for white or pastel furniture where yellowing would compromise the intended aesthetic.
Dead Flat Varnish provides ultra-matt protection for timber where any sheen would be inappropriate. This specialized finish suits period restoration, arts and crafts furniture, and contemporary designs requiring completely non-reflective surfaces.
Paints for Exterior and Interior Timber
While Ronseal is best known for stains and varnishes, their paint range delivers comparable performance in opaque finishes. The products are formulated specifically for timber rather than being general-purpose paints, ensuring proper adhesion and flexibility for wooden substrates.
Exterior Wood Paint provides long-lasting protection for external doors, windows, cladding, and garden structures. Available in a comprehensive color range, it delivers up to six years of protection with proper preparation. The microporous formulation allows moisture to escape from timber while preventing external water ingress, reducing the risk of rot and decay.
10 Year Weatherproof Paint extends protection even further, offering a decade of performance for exterior woodwork. This advanced formulation incorporates UV stabilizers and flexible resins that prevent cracking and fading, maintaining appearance through years of British weather.
For interior applications, One Coat Furniture Paint provides effortless updates for wooden furniture without extensive preparation. The self-priming formula covers most surfaces with a single coat, making furniture renovation accessible to users without professional decorating experience.
Wood Preservers and Treatment Products
Beyond decorative finishes, Ronseal manufactures essential treatment products that address timber problems and provide invisible protection. These specialized products tackle the practical challenges of maintaining timber in challenging environments.
Total Wood Preserver combines insecticide, fungicide, and wood hardener in a single treatment, addressing multiple timber threats simultaneously. It kills existing woodworm infestations, prevents fungal attack, and hardens softened timber, making it valuable for treating structural timber before decoration or in maintenance applications.
Wet Rot Wood Hardener stabilizes timber damaged by fungal decay, allowing repair and redecoration where replacement might otherwise be necessary. The low-viscosity formula penetrates deep into affected timber, binding fibers and restoring structural integrity to damaged sections.
Fence Life Preserver provides invisible protection for fences and garden timber before applying colored stains. This base treatment extends the service life of exterior timber by preventing rot and insect damage from establishing in fresh or treated timber.
Problem-Solving Products
Ronseal's problem-solver range addresses specific timber challenges that standard products can't handle. Knot Stop Stabilising Solution seals resinous knots in softwood, preventing resin bleed-through that ruins paint and varnish finishes. This is essential preparation for pine, spruce, and other softwoods where knots would otherwise cause finishing problems.
Dampness Wood Sealer provides protection for timber in high-moisture environments like bathrooms and kitchens. It seals timber against moisture ingress while allowing existing dampness to escape, reducing rot risk in challenging locations.
Decking Oils and Maintenance Products
Ronseal's decking oil range provides alternative protection to stains, delivering natural-looking finishes that enhance timber grain while providing water resistance. The oils penetrate timber rather than forming surface films, giving a more natural appearance that suits contemporary decking aesthetics.
Ultimate Protection Decking Oil combines UV filters with water-repellent resins, protecting decking from both sun damage and moisture. Regular application maintains timber in excellent condition, preventing the splitting and warping that occurs when decking weathers naturally.
Deck Rescue Paint tackles decking beyond maintenance, covering weathered, grey boards with opaque protection in a range of colors. Unlike standard paints that peel from decking, this flexible formulation moves with the timber, maintaining coverage through seasonal expansion and contraction.
Primers and Preparation Products
Proper preparation determines finish durability, and Ronseal manufactures specialized primers that ensure optimal adhesion and performance. Precision Finish Multi Surface Primer provides universal priming for timber, metal, and plastic, simplifying preparation when decorating varied materials.
Wood Primer seals and prepares bare timber for painting, preventing resin bleed-through while ensuring paint adhesion. The quick-drying formula accelerates project timelines, allowing same-day topcoat application in many cases.
For problem surfaces, Ronseal's specialist primers address specific challenges. High Performance Wood Filler provides invisible repairs for damaged timber, accepting stains and paints without showing repairs. The two-pack formulation delivers exceptional strength, allowing structural repairs where standard fillers would fail.
